    I visited a web site selling a particular product whose ad I saw on YouTube. I submitted a comment via their on-line form. I then received an email from them which addressed me w/ the nickname I usually use when registering on other web sites. I have never registered onto this particular site so I do not know how they could know the nickname. I replied to the email requesting from where they obtained the nickname. They informed me it was via my email account even though I gave them only my gmail address. The nickname they utilized is not associated w/ my gmail account. I resent an email to them stating I believe they contacted other web sites and requested my nickname based on the email address I always use which is the same email address I gave them and requested they inform me of the web site which provided them w/ my nickname. Of course they did not reply. This was six days ago. May I inquire if anyone here has had a similar experience or knows how they might have obtained my nickname or how I might otherwise determine the site which provided it to them or knows if their presumed actions violate any laws?
